Photoelectrochemistry by Design: Tailoring the Nanoscale Structure of Pt/NiO Composites Leads to Enhanced Photoelectrochemical Hydrogen Evolution Performance
[Image: see text] Photoelectrochemical hydrogen evolution is a promising avenue to store the energy of sunlight in the form of chemical bonds.
